Komodo Island Destination

Located at the heart of Indonesia's Lesser Sunda Islands, Komodo Island is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and one of the most distinctive travel destinations in Southeast Asia. This island is home to the world's largest living lizard, the Komodo dragon, and boasts a unique landscape of green hills, white sandy beaches, and clear blue seas.

Why Visit Komodo Island

Komodo Island is not just another tropical destination. It is one of only four islands in the world where wild Komodo dragons still roam, and it offers encounters that no other place on the planet can replicate. With approximately 1,700 Komodo dragons on the island, you'll have the opportunity to witness these ancient reptiles in their natural habitat, living alongside local communities in a way that feels genuinely primeval. No zoo or wildlife park can replicate this experience.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best time to visit Komodo Island?
The best time to visit Komodo Island is during the dry season, which runs from April to June and September. These months offer excellent conditions with fewer crowds and sunny skies. However, if you're looking for manta ray sightings, the wet season from October to March is a good time to visit.
What activities can I do around Komodo Island?
Komodo National Park offers a range of activities, including diving, snorkeling, sailing, and trekking. With a private yacht, you'll have access to a rotating itinerary of activities, each with its own optimal timing, ideal sea conditions, and character.
Can I visit Komodo Island during the wet season?
Yes, Komodo Island remains open and visitable during the wet season. However, sea conditions may be rougher, and rainfall is higher. Manta ray sightings are more frequent during this period, making it a compelling reason for divers to visit off-peak.
